Certified Specialist Programme in Shape Memory Polymers (SMPs) is increasingly significant for professionals in smart city development. The UK's construction sector, responsible for a substantial portion of the country's carbon footprint, is actively seeking sustainable solutions. According to a recent report by the UK Green Building Council, 40% of UK construction emissions originate from material production. SMPs, with their unique properties of shape recovery and responsiveness, offer an innovative approach to address this challenge. They find applications in self-healing infrastructure, adaptable building facades, and smart sensors. This growing demand fuels the need for specialists with in-depth knowledge of SMPs' design, manufacturing, and implementation within smart city contexts.
